Chef with Michelin-star status makes heartfelt plea to thieves who stole $30,000 worth of pies during the holiday season


Chef Tommy Banks had his van stolen, containing $30,000 worth of pies. Despite being devastated, Banks appealed to the thieves to donate the pies to people in need. The refrigerated van was filled with 2,500 pies in various flavors. Banks urged the thieves to drop off the pies so they could feed people who are in need of a hot meal. He acknowledged that the chances of recovering the stolen pies were slim, but he hoped they could be used to help others. Banks also asked the public to report anyone offering pies with his branding that are not from him. He had a harsher message for the thieves, wishing they would not receive any presents for Christmas. Overall, Banks expressed his disappointment but remained hopeful that the stolen pies could be put to good use in helping those less fortunate during the holiday season.
